Effect of phosphorus supplementation on growth, nutrient uptake, physiological responses, and cadmium absorption by tall fescue (Festuca arundinacea Schreb.) exposed to cadmium

Cadmium is a common heavy metal pollutant. In some plants, its absorption is inhibited by exogenous phosphorus.
